Bathed in the soft, diffused light of a setting sun, this cityscape captures the quiet majesty of London's Waterloo Bridge. The artist's brushwork is delicate and textured, layers of pastel hues blending with a misty atmosphere that gently obscures the skyline. The composition balances the solid structure of the bridge with the ephemeral glow of the sun, casting a warm, golden haze over the water below. The muted palette of blues, pinks, and ochres evokes a moment suspended in time, where the bustle of the city is softened into a serene, almost dreamlike silence.

The impressionistic technique here invites you to feel the cool air and hear the faint ripple of the river beneath the arches. This work resonates with a sense of calm and reflection, perhaps a subtle homage to the resilience and enduring spirit of London during the difficult era of 1918. It stands as a timeless tribute to the beauty found in everyday urban scenes, transforming an ordinary bridge at dusk into a poetic vision of light, shadow, and atmosphere.
